“Make slides that reinforce your words, not repeat them.” Seth Godin, Marketing Guru
![Page 3: Great Advice for Using Slideware](https://reader036.vdocuments.site/reader036/viewer/2022081518/5457e8f6af79592b448b521b/html5/thumbnails/3.jpg)
“People can only process one inbound message at a time. They will either listen to you or read your slides; they cannot do both.” Nancy Duarte, Author Resonate

“If all you want to do is create a file of facts and figures, then cancel the meeting and send in a report.” !Seth Godin, Marketing Guru
![Page 8: Great Advice for Using Slideware](https://reader036.vdocuments.site/reader036/viewer/2022081518/5457e8f6af79592b448b521b/html5/thumbnails/8.jpg)
“A traditional slide that duplicates the presenter’s words is more of a reading test than a visual.”
Garr Reynolds, Author Presentation Zen

“Your goal is to move away from projecting a document
and toward giving a presentation.” Nancy Duarte, Author, Resonate

“Attempting to have slides serve both as projected visuals and as stand-alone handouts makes for bad visuals and bad documentation.” Garr Reynolds, Author Presentation Zen

“Hear a piece of information, and three days later you'll remember 10% of it. Add a picture and you'll remember 65%.” John Medina, Neuroscientist

“[Presentation technologies] are only useful to the degree that they make things clearer and more memorable.” Garr Reynolds, Author Presentation Zen

“PowerPoint doesn’t kill meetings. People kill meetings. But using PowerPoint is like having a loaded AK-47 on the table: You can do very bad things with it.” Peter Norvig, Google Director of Research

“Simplify the slides so the audience can process each one in under !three seconds.” !
Nancy Duarte, Author Resonate
